Who We Are

At Life Leisure, we really love what we do and the people we do it for. We believe that physical activity can enhance the health and well-being of communities, and we work to positively impact the mental, social and physical good health of local people.

We are a Community Interest Company (CIC) wholly owned by Stockport Metropolitan Borough Council and work to ensure all residents can access affordable provision within their communities.

Our ‘Purpose’ is simple: “we exist to improve the lives of others”. This drives everything we do at work and is as relevant for our workforce as it is for our customers, and our mission is “to develop a healthier and more active community”.

We enshrine all of this into our strap-line “Live well, live life”

Agency Partnership with Stockport Council

Stockport Active CIC (t/a as Life Leisure) is acting as an agent for Stockport Council.

FAQs

What does this change mean for customers of Life Leisure?

There will be no visible change in the way that Life Leisure will be operating. However, you will start to see the Stockport Metropolitan Borough Council logo on some of our signage and marketing materials to indicate the new agent relationship. All your membership details will also remain with Life Leisure.

Will this change affect Life Leisure pricing?

No, there will not be any changes to our prices across Life Leisure.

Does this change mean I will need to contact Stockport Metropolitan Borough Council for any enquiries/requests?

No, you will not need to contact Stockport Metropolitan Borough Council. Please continue to contact Life Leisure for all membership enquiries and any other hub enquiries through our available email addresses or our website.

Are there any additional benefits or services accompanying the agency change?

There will not be anything additional, however Life Leisure will always continue to work hard in the background to review our services and benefits for our members to provide even greater value through our hubs. These improvements are designed to enhance your overall experience. Please download the Life Leisure app or follow us on our social media platforms for the latest updates.

Is there any action required on my part?

You do not need to take any action. Should you have any enquiries, please do not hesitate to get in touch. Our teams are here to address any concerns or questions you may have.

Life Leisure run an extensive mix of sports and leisure facilities, ranging from small community recreation centres to large multi use sport and leisure facilities. In addition we deliver sporting activities and health programmes of the highest quality to those people who for one reason or another cannot access a local facility.
